Abstract :
An off-line handwritten Chinese character recognition system based on feedback structure with statistical error of generalized literacy is constructed in this paper by imitating the feedback behavior of repeatedly considering in the human brain. Four kinds of general literacy errors are defined, which are rough error of aberration comparison, detail error of character characteristic, characteristic of detail error and matching trend error. According to the statistical analysis, rough error of aberration comparison and detail error of character characteristic is given by random statistical properties. The feedback mechanisms and decision-making strategies are adjusted by characteristic of detail error and matching trend error. The results of simulation show that this system is efficient.
